What are Live Dealer Games?
Live Dealer Games provide an immersive experience by connecting players with real dealers through high-definition streaming video. The game unfolds in real-time, allowing players to interact with the dealer and fellow players, fostering a social atmosphere akin to that of a land-based casino. Key features include:
- Real-time interaction: Players can communicate with dealers via chat.
- Authenticity: The action unfolds in real-time, enhancing trust and transparency.
- Variety: Available games include bl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ker.
What are RNG Games?
RNG Games utilize software algorithms to ensure randomness in game outcomes. This format is often characterized by its fast-paced nature and availability of numerous variations. Players can enjoy a plethora of options, including slots, video poker, and classic table games. Key components include:
- Speed: Quick gameplay allows for multiple rounds in a short timeframe.
- Accessibility: Available 24/7 without the need for a stable internet connection.
- Wide selection: A vast array of games with diverse themes and features.
How do the RTP Rates Compare?
The Return to Player (RTP) percentage is a critical metric for evaluating the profitability of both game types. Typically, RTP for Live Dealer Games ranges from 92% to 97%, depending on the specific game and its rules. In contrast, RNG Games can have an RTP as high as 98%, especially in slots. Understanding these percentages helps players make informed decisions about where to invest their time and money.

Common Myths about Live Dealer and RNG Games
- Myth 1: Live Dealer Games are rigged.
- Myth 2: RNG Games are less fair than Live Dealer Games.
- Myth 3: You cannot chat with dealers in RNG Games.
Addressing these myths is crucial for players. Live Dealer Games operate under stringent regulations and are monitored for fairness. Likewise, reputable online casinos ensure that RNG algorithms are independently tested for compliance and randomness.
